]> git.ipfire.org Git - thirdparty/gcc.git/commitdiff
Check if GCC uses assembler cfi support
authorRainer Orth <ro@CeBiTec.Uni-Bielefeld.DE>
Wed, 9 Apr 2014 14:57:48 +0000 (14:57 +0000)
committerRainer Orth <ro@gcc.gnu.org>
Wed, 9 Apr 2014 14:57:48 +0000 (14:57 +0000)
* config/generic/asmcfi.h: Also check for
__GCC_HAVE_DWARF2_CFI_ASM.

From-SVN: r209245

libitm/ChangeLog
libitm/config/generic/asmcfi.h

index 12636cc4fb71ea699eca959ab3c00b9500c7391a..b94cd32cfd1e96435d8b9dfff281dacde059ab47 100644 (file)
@@ -1,3 +1,8 @@
+2014-04-09  Rainer Orth  <ro@CeBiTec.Uni-Bielefeld.DE>
+
+       * config/generic/asmcfi.h: Also check for
+       __GCC_HAVE_DWARF2_CFI_ASM.
+
 2013-04-11  Release Manager
 
        * GCC 4.7.3 released.
index 3a5634b37e6242f8ee70df4002be01d17894b3b2..5bf7f4524cab7c6a601fdc3fa68dc8e5f91dc534 100644 (file)
@@ -24,7 +24,7 @@
 
 #include "config.h"
 
-#ifdef HAVE_AS_CFI_PSEUDO_OP
+#if defined(HAVE_AS_CFI_PSEUDO_OP) && defined(__GCC_HAVE_DWARF2_CFI_ASM)
 
 #define cfi_startproc                  .cfi_startproc
 #define cfi_endproc                    .cfi_endproc
@@ -50,4 +50,4 @@
 #define cfi_restore(r)
 #define cfi_undefined(r)
 
-#endif /* HAVE_AS_CFI_PSEUDO_OP */
+#endif /* HAVE_AS_CFI_PSEUDO_OP && __GCC_HAVE_DWARF2_CFI_ASM */